Oyster catches bird!

Actually, according to Dr. Darren Naish's collected data, it happens a lot. Bivalves which snap their shells together at the right time can damage the beaks of birds. Occasionally, they clamp shut and stay that way, while the bird can't eat or sometimes can't fly. Sometimes the bird drowns.
